> The old binding was covering the whole DMU block space (DMU block
> contains CRU block which contains USB PHY). It was a bad design,
> overkill and a non-generic solution.
>
> Northstar's USB 2.0 PHY is a small block (part of the CRU MFD) and
> binding should be designed to represent that properly. Rework the
> binding to map just PHY with the "reg" property and use syscon to
> reference shared register that controls block access.
>
> The old binding is deprecated now.
